QUINCY, ILL. -- Mitt Romney supporters gathered Wednesday night to cheer on their candidate at the first debate between President Obama and Mitt Romney.
WTAD Radio hosted the event at the Blind Pig Bar in Quincy.
Both men took on the two of the biggest issues facing americans today, healthcare and the economy.
Some people watched the debates from the bar, others watched from a specially set up viewing room.
Before the debate we asked one Romney supporter what she wanted to hear from her candidate.
"I want to hear how the economy is going to benefit. We need to get more jobs. We need to focus on getting better jobs in this area, definitely, but also across the country," Sally Blickhan said. "And I want to hear, I want hear how that's going to happen."
